Why Braid 15 Lb Carp Fishing Is Necessary

I use 15 lb braid for carp fishing because it gives me the right balance of strength, sensitivity, and control. When I am fishing for carp, I want to feel every bite quickly, and braid helps me do that much better than monofilament. Its low stretch lets me detect even the slightest movement, which is especially useful when carp are being cautious.

My experience has also shown me that 15 lb braid is strong enough to handle hard fights without feeling too heavy or bulky. Carp can make powerful runs, and having that extra strength gives me confidence when I am playing a fish near weeds, snags, or reeds. I also like that braid cuts through water well, which helps my rig stay more direct and responsive.

For me, using 15 lb braid is necessary because it improves both bite detection and hook-setting power. It helps me fish more effectively in different conditions and gives me a better chance of landing carp safely. In short, it is a line weight I trust when I want performance and reliability on the bank.

My Buying Guides on Braid 15 Lb Carp Fishing

Why I Choose 15 Lb Braid for Carp Fishing

When I fish for carp, I like 15 lb braid because it gives me a strong balance of sensitivity and control. I can feel bites more clearly than with thicker lines, and I also get better casting distance. In my experience, this strength is a good fit for general carp fishing, especially when I want a line that is tough but still manageable.

What I Look for in Braid Quality

My first check is always the quality of the braid itself. I prefer a line that feels smooth, round, and consistent. A good braid should not fray easily, and it should hold up well against repeated casting. I also look for low stretch because it helps me detect movement and set the hook more effectively.

Breaking Strain and Real Strength

Even though the label says 15 lb, I always pay attention to the actual performance of the line. Some braids can feel stronger than their rating, while others may be weaker when wet or under pressure. I usually choose a braid from a trusted brand so I know the strength rating is reliable for carp fishing conditions.

Diameter Matters More Than I First Thought

I learned that diameter is just as important as breaking strain. A thinner braid lets me cast farther and reduces resistance in the water. That said, I make sure it is not so thin that it becomes difficult to handle or too easy to damage. For me, a good 15 lb braid should stay thin but still feel durable.

Visibility and Color Choice

I pay attention to the color of the braid depending on where I fish. If I want better visibility above water, I choose a brighter color so I can track my line more easily. If I want a stealthier setup, I go for a darker or more natural shade. My choice depends on water clarity, light conditions, and how cautious the carp are.

Knot Strength and Ease of Tying

A braid can be strong on paper, but if the knots fail, it is no use to me. I always check whether the line is easy to tie and whether it holds knots well. I prefer braid that works nicely with common fishing knots and does not slip when tightened properly.

Abrasion Resistance for Carp Waters

When I fish near reeds, rocks, snags, or weed beds, abrasion resistance becomes very important. I want a braid that can handle rough edges without breaking too quickly. For carp fishing, I think this is one of the most important features because carp often run into heavy cover.

Matching the Braid to My Reel and Rod

I always make sure the braid suits my reel and rod setup. A 15 lb braid should spool neatly and not dig into itself too much. I also check that my rod has the right action to work well with braid, since braid has very little stretch and can feel much sharper than monofilament.

Best Situations for 15 Lb Carp Braid

In my experience, 15 lb braid works best for medium-range carp fishing, lighter rigs, and situations where I need sensitivity. I like it for open water, controlled swims, and places where I want more bite detection. If I know I’ll be fishing heavy snags or very large carp, I may consider a heavier option.

My Final Buying Advice

When I buy 15 lb carp braid, I focus on strength, diameter, abrasion resistance, knot performance, and visibility. I do not just look at the label; I think about how the line will perform on the bank. For me, the best braid is the one that gives confidence, casts well, and stands up to real carp fishing conditions.
